Lay day at Margaret River Pro

A lay day has delayed Stephanie Gilmore's Margaret River Pro quarter-final with Sally Fitzgibbons. (AAP)

Small surf and unfavourable winds have prompted organisers to call a lay day at the Margaret River Pro.

The next call will be made at 0915 AEST on Thursday.

"The small swell has stuck around this morning and the wind is expected to get worse throughout the day," said World Surf League head of competition Jessi Miley-Dyer.

"The forecast suggests that we have plenty of swell on the way and light winds for much of the remainder of the window."

On Tuesday, Australians Stephanie Gilmore, Sally Fitzgibbons, Isabella Nicholls, Tyler Wright and Bronte Macaulay all advanced to the quarter-finals in the fourth event on the 2021 WSL tour.

The men's event is through to the round of 16 with Julian Wilson and Ryan Callinan the only remaining Australians.
